A routine walk to collect fodder for her family's livestock changed Fatima Zailai's life forever. A landmine hidden along a road in Hiran District, Hajjah Governorate, severely injured her right leg and left her confined to a wheelchair. #Houthi#landmines continue to threaten civilians carrying out everyday activities across #Yemen.

When a #landmine exploded beneath what his family believed was a safe road, Hadi Mutanabbek lost his right leg while fleeing the conflict in #Yemen. More than five years later, he continues to support his family by transporting passengers between villages in Midi District. His story reflects the lasting impact of landmines on civilians, livelihoods, and #recovery.

Project Masam's demining Team 38 has responded to a report of #landmines discovered near homes in Bani Fayd, Midi District, Hajjah Gov., dismantling two banned #Houthi anti-personnel mines during its initial survey. Midi remains one of #Yemen's most heavily contaminated areas after years of #conflict, with mines continuing to threaten civilians, livestock, and livelihoods.

Project Masam teams have cleared 798 explosive threats across #Yemen during the week of 30 May-5 June 2026, including 11 anti-personnel mines, six anti-tank mines and 781 UXO, while securing 184,544 m² of land.

Since mid-2018, Project Masam has cleared 565,137 explosive threats across #Yemen, including 7,340 anti-personnel #landmines, 151,456 anti-tank mines, 8,462 IEDs and 397,879 UXO, making more than 80.8 million m² of land safe.

In 2022, States Parties to the #Ottawa Convention granted #Yemen a five-year extension to meet its mine clearance obligations, extending the country's Article 5 deadline until 1 March 2028. The decision recognised the scale of contamination affecting communities across Yemen. But, years later, contamination continues to threaten civilians across Yemen, despite increasing efforts to clear these deadly devices.
